
STEVE
MURPHY
DRUMS/VOCALS
Steve Murphy is a drummer/singer/producer/engineer who has been heavily involved in the NY music scene since the late ’80s. The artists he has performed and recorded with are some of the most famous and recognizable names in music over the last 60 years. In 1998 he was asked to work as a vocalist in the studio with legendary producer Phil Ramone on a project for Elton John. His voice was featured on dozens of national commercials including The Army’s “Be All You Can Be” campaign. He was a member of The Alan Parsons Live Project touring over 40 countries. He has also toured with Jack Bruce (Cream), The Who (John Entwistle), Eric Burdon and the Animals, Chuck Negron
(3 Dog Night), Felix Cavaliere (The Rascals), Steve Augieri (Journey), Todd Rundgren and more.

MIKE
DIMEO
KEYS/VOCALS
Mike DiMeo is a multi- keyboard expert and vocalist. His years as the organist for Tommy James and The Shondells
opened the door to his long list of collaborations including performances with Deep Purple, Johnny Winter, Tommy James, Bonnie Tyler and more.

MARK
NEWMAN
GUITAR/VOCALS
Mark Newman is a critically acclaimed slide guitar master in the tradition of George Harrison and Eric Clapton. His solo blues career has yielded multiple charted recordings including his most recent release, “Empirical Truth” which is currently top 10 on the Blues chart. His collaborations include: John Oates (Hall & Oates), Bobby Whitlock (Derek & The Dominoes), and Tommy James & The Shondells.

TONY
TINO
BASS/VOCALS
Tony Tino is a veteran bassist who has been on the NYC music scene for 30 years. He has performed, recorded, and toured with Bruce Springsteen, Jon Bon Jovi, Gavin DeGraw, Nelly McKay, Ronnie Spector, Robert Randolph, Southside Johnny and The Asbury Jukes and many more.

TOMMY
WILLIAMS
GUITAR/VOCALS
Musical director/guitarist for Debbie Gibson (including the #1 “Lost In Your Eyes,” three albums and two world tours). Tommy Williams has performed with Tommy Shaw of Styx, Cheap Trick’s Rick Nielsen and Robin Zander, Leroy Clouden of Steely Dan, Denny Laine of Wings, Joey Molland of Badfinger and more.
